Associations Call to Walk Between Paris and Brussels for Gaza

Summary by valeursactuelles.com
They want to link Brussels from Paris. Several associations, including the Ligue des droits de l'homme (LDH), the Belgo-Palestinian Association (ABP), the Association France Palestine Solidarité (AFPS), the FSU, Solidaires, the International Federation for Human Rights (FIDH) and the CGT Union, call for a walk from Paris to Brussels for Gaza, says Europe 1.The participants call on "political leaders throughout the EU and European institutions to…

A dozen activists, supported by public figures, have embarked on a symbolic journey to the European capital to demand concrete measures against the humanitarian crisis in Gaza. A group of committed citizens, including actress Corinne Masiero, took the start of a peaceful march between Paris and Brussels this Sunday. [...] Read more » Citizen's march Paris-Brussels: protesters calling for Europe on Gaza » appeared first on Le Singulier.

Several associations and trade unions are organising a march from Paris to Brussels in support of the Gazaoui population and in order to demand action from the European authorities. The march starts on Sunday 15 June and will take place in seven cities of the Hauts-de-France before arriving in Brussels on 23 June.

French trade unions and associations call for a march from Paris to Brussels on Sunday to put pressure on the European authorities to impose sanctions on Israel and to stop the massacre in Gaza. Participants call on EU-wide political leaders and the European institutions to exert without any delay maximum pressure on the Israeli government to put an end to the massacre in Gaza, after 616 days of war, summarizes in a communiqué the Co-organising …
